Terms of Reference for Consultant Data Analyst

Background
: The Alliance for a Green Revolution in Africa (AGRA, www.agra.org) is a not-for-profit organization working with African governments, other donors, NGOs, the private sector, and African farmers to significantly and sustainably improve the productivity and incomes of resource poor  smallholder farmers in Africa. 
AGRA aims to ensure that smallholders have what they need to succeed: good seeds and healthy soils; access to markets, information, financing, storage and transport; and policies that provide them with comprehensive support. 
Recognizing that inappropriate or poorly implemented policies can blunt incentives for investment in productivity-enhancing products and services, AGRA’s Policy and Advocacy Program leads the organization’s efforts to strengthen Africa’s food and agricultural policy systems over the long-term while spurring reform and innovation in the short-term.

AGRA has developed a new Advocacy Strategy. Under the Strategy, AGRA’s advocacy mission is to be a clear and consistent voice for an evidence-based, market-driven, smallholder farmer-led Green Revolution in Africa. The anticipated outcomes of AGRA advocacy are: (1) scaled innovative models; and (2) reformed policies.

In view of the above, AGRA seeks a consultant to support analytical and writing work related to implementation of the new Advocacy Strategy. The consultant will use his/her expertise to acquire, organize, analyze, and load data related to AGRA and its investments, and to the countries and value chains in which AGRA invests, aiming to build an understanding about opportunities, challenges and priorities for policy reform and scaling innovative models.

Scope of Work: Using methods of data mining, statistics, and data visualization, the consultant will assist staff in AGRA’s Policy and Advocacy Program to identify and present underlying trends and patterns in macro and micro variables relevant to AGRA’s mandate. 

The consultant will perform advanced analytics on large unstructured and structured datasets related to African and global agricultural development, aiming to measure, interpret, and predict trends and patterns of relevance to AGRA.
